NEET
The National Eligibility cum Entrance Test (NEET) is conducted by NTA for admission to various undergraduate medical courses in India. It is the largest and most important medical entrance exam in India. NEET is also the sole entrance test for admission to any medical course in India. Since 2021, NEET scores are also used for BSc Nursing admission as well. Aspirants can check the table below to know the NEET exam dates.

NEET is a paper-pencil-based (PBT) or offline test which is conducted for a duration of 200 minutes or three hours and 20 minutes. The exam consists of three subjects, Physics, Chemistry and Biology. Each subject is further divided into two sections, Section A (35 questions) and Section B (15 questions). Candidates have to attempt 10 out of 15 questions in Section B. Each question carries four marks and one mark is deducted for each wrong answer. The total marks of NEET is 720. The exam is conducted in 13 languages - English, Hindi, Bengali, Assamese, Odia, Punjabi, Gujarati, Marathi, Malayalam, Tamil, Telugu, Kannada and Urdu.

NEET PG
National Eligibility cum Entrance Test for Post-Graduation is conducted by NBE for admission to MD/MS/PG Diploma/DNB post-MBBS courses in India. NEET PG scores are widely accepted for admission to these courses. The exam is conducted in computer-based mode (CBT) for a duration of 3.5 hours. There are 200 multiple-choice questions (MCQs). Each correct answer will fetch four marks whereas, for each wrong answer, one mark will be deducted. The question paper is divided into three sections with a varying number of questions. The medium of questions is English.

NEET MDS
National Eligibility cum Entrance Examination for MDS courses, or NEET MDS, is another examination conducted by NBE. NEET MDS is conducted once, every year, for admissions to postgraduate dental courses in India. NEET MDS is a computer-based test of three hours duration carrying 240 MCQs. Each question carries four marks and there is a negative marking of one mark for each wrong answer.

INI CET
INI CET is conducted by AIIMS, Delhi for admission to its postgraduate courses. Apart from MD/MS courses, the exam scores are also used for admission to the six years DM/MCh courses offered at AIIMS, JIPMER, PGIMER and NIMHANS. Admission to the MDS courses in this institute is also through the same entrance test. AIIMS PG is conducted twice a year, in the months of January and July.

FMGE
Foreign Medical Graduate Examination, popularly known as FMGE, is conducted by NBE. FMGE is a licensing examination conducted for those who wish to practice medicine in India, but have completed their primary medical qualification from outside India. FMGE is conducted twice in a year. One must note that clearing this examination will not lead to admissions but a practising license.
The mode of this exam is online. FMGE is conducted for a duration of 300 minutes. The total number of questions for the exam is 300, each carrying one mark. There is no negative marking scheme in the exam. The exam will be conducted in two phases of 2.5 hours duration each.

AIAPGET
All India AYUSH Postgraduate Entrance Test, or AIAPGET, is conducted by NTA annually. AIAPGET is an entrance test conducted for admissions to postgraduate AYUSH courses in India. Qualifying for the AIAPGET exam will give the candidates to take admission to MS, MD or PG diploma courses in either of the following AYUSH disciplines; Ayurveda, Unani, Siddha and Homeopathy.
AIAPGET is conducted for a duration of two hours in a computer-based mode (CBT). The question paper will comprise 120 multiple-choice questions carrying a total of 480 marks. The exam will be conducted in two shifts. Each question carries four marks and there is one mark of negative marking for each wrong answer.

DNB PDCET
Diplomate of National Board Post Diploma Centralized Entrance Test, abbreviated as DNB PDCET, is a ranking examination conducted by NBE. As the name suggests, DNB PDCET is conducted for admission to DNB courses in India. However, the applicants must possess a postgraduate diploma to apply for the DNB PDCET exam.
DNB PDCET is conducted once a year in a computer-based mode for a duration of two hours. Each question carries four marks and there is a negative marking of one mrk for each incorrect response.

NEET SS
The National Eligibility cum Entrance Test (Super Speciality Courses) or NEET SS is conducted by NBE for admission to various DM/MCh courses. NEET SS scores are accepted by all private medical colleges/universities, deemed universities and the Armed forces medical services institutions. However, the following institutions do not accept the scores of NEET SS and conduct a separate entrance test for admissions to their super-speciality courses; AIIMS, PGIMER, JIPMER, NIMHANS, SCTIMST.
NEET SS is conducted annually in a computer-based mode for 3.5 hours duration. There are 100 questions in total carrying four marks each. There is a negative marking of one mark for each wrong answer. The medium or language of the question paper is English only.
